Seth Rozanoff (b.Kalamazoo ->NL->IRL->SCOT), NOW based in Ho Chi Minh City(VN) – sound artist/electronic musician – Notable works, cluster_remix (2023) mix_water (2022), and error_mix (2022), generative audiovisual, shown at EVAC’s Journeys (East Village, NYC) –  Geometries 0, 00, 000, and 0//0 (2020), audiovisual installation, at SONDA Festival Elektroakustické Hudby & Audiovizuálních Performancí (Brno) – 0, Living Lab Music 9 in Venezia – New Geometries (2021), audiovisual, included in 7a Ecos Urbanos-Monterrey – Restful Silence (2022), fixed soundscape, included in Vibération #4, a Headphone concert from Le Pharo in Marseille – Repetition-Duo (2021), audiovisual, included in the 8th Saarbrücken Days for Electronic and Visual MusicDuoLoop (2020), a soundscape drawing from recorded environmental material in Sao Paulo, heard on WebSYNradio (France) 2021 – Noise Variations (2021) and Geometries 000, 0//0 (2020) (both audiovisual) included in Curat10n Open Art Festival 2021 (UK) – Mixed Repetitions (2019-20) (audiovisual) shown at NYCEMF 2020 – Surfaces (2019) (fixed soundscape) heard at Festival Supersonique 2022 (Marseille), on Concertzender-Electronic Frequencies Series (Netherlands) 2021 and MUSLAB 2020 – In-Side-Alt (2019) (audiovisual), also seen at MUSLAB in Mexico City – New Repetitions (2018-) (audiovisual) seen at IN-Sonora 11 (2020) Madrid – Qu-Extensions (2017), an electroacoustic improvisation, heard at Yongin Poeun Art Gallery Outdoor Exhibition Korea, Radiophrenia Broadcast Glasgow, Concertzender (NL), NYCEMF, Autumn e-sound festival 2018 Osaka, and New Adventures in Sound Art Toronto. He has performed a range of live electronic work at places such as Sonorities Festival (N.IRL), Soundthought (Scotland), SoundLab at Glasgow City Halls, Tramway (Glasgow), and Roulette (NYC).
